Speaker of Milli Majlis Sahiba Gafarova meets with Member of U.S. Congress’ House of Representatives Abraham Hamadeh

Speaker of the Milli Majlis Sahiba Gafarova has met with the visiting Member of the House of Representatives of the U.S. Congress Abraham Hamadeh on 17 June.
The recent development of the high-level relations between the USA and Azerbaijan was brought up at the meeting. It was said that those relations rested on mutual respect and common interests as well as on the foundations serving peace, security and progress.
The Speaker of the Milli Majlis touched upon the role of the United States and President Donald Trump in supporting peace and stability in our region, mentioning in this context the Washington Summit and its successful outcomes. A relevant special session having been organised at the Milli Majlis of Azerbaijan was mentioned as well.
The importance of the initialing of the peace treaty and of the signing of the tripartite Joint Declaration in Washington, D.C. for restoration of peace and stability in the region were stressed during the conversation. At the same time, it was remarked that the TRIPP Corridor was going to contribute importantly to the progress of regional transport liaisons as well as to deepening peace and co-operation in the region.
Speaker Sahiba Gafarova emphasised the historic significance of President Ilham Aliyev’s latest visits to Washington, D.C. and of the meetings of the Head of the Azerbaijani State with President Donald Trump in terms of the bilateral relationship’s advancement. The remarkable role in a continued expansion of our relations of the signing of the Charter on Strategic Partnership between the Government of the Republic of Azerbaijan and the Government of the United States of America, signed during Vice President J. D. Vance’s visit to our country, was underlined, too.
Member of the U.S. Congress’ House of Representatives Abraham Hamadeh expressed his gratitude for the high-standard hospitality extended to him and voiced his wish to see the Speaker of the Azerbaijani Parliament at the U.S. Congress.
As the conversation continued, Abraham Hamadeh remarked upon the significance of the USA-Azerbaijan relations and mentioned their current development in various directions. He described Azerbaijan as a country of special significance due to her geographic position as well as in view of the role she plays in international co-operation.
The guest also high-lit the strengthening of peace in the region and touched upon the importance of peace between Azerbaijan and Armenia.
Speaker Sahiba Gafarova lauded in the conversation President Donald Trump’s signing of the memorandum extending the suspension of the 907th Amendment to the Freedom Support Act, saying that that helps facilitate practical co-operation of our countries in areas of shared interest. Lauding also the acts by the U.S. Congress Members motioning initiatives to strengthen the bilateral relations and eliminating the hurdles no longer reflective of the current reality of our countries’ partnership, the Speaker of the Milli Majlis emphasised in this regard the significance of Abraham Hamadeh’s co-authorship of the Bill introduced in the US Congress to repeal Section 907 of the Freedom Support Act.
As she was talking about the peace agenda between Azerbaijan and Armenia, she mentioned the four meetings she had had with the Speaker of the Armenian Parliament.
Speaker Sahiba Gafarova informed the guest, as the conversation went on, of our country’s history of democratic development and the multicultural environment and tolerance traditions found in Azerbaijan as well as the activities of the Milli Majlis, its co-operation with parliaments of other countries and international parliamentary organisations alike and about also other matters of interest.
Besides, development of the relations between the Milli Majlis of Azerbaijan and the U.S. Congress was broached during the conversation.
